'I want to play in attack' - Peter Olayinka says after scoring ten minutes into APOEL home debut

Peter Olayinka scored ten minutes into his APOEL home debut as the Cypriot First Division giants defeated Francis Uzoho's Omonia 1-0 in the Nicosia derby staged at the GSP Stadium on Sunday, February 22.

The breakthrough for the Blue and Yellow arrived in the 81st minute when Olayinka calmly finished from inside the box to make it 1–0, and APOEL held on until the final whistle to seal a memorable victory in the Derby of the Eternal Enemies.

Three months after leaving Red Star Belgrade by mutual consent, the Nigeria international joined APOEL as a free agent, signing a short-term deal until the end of the 2025-2026 season.

Olayinka was delighted to score on his APOEL home debut, and also highlighted the electric atmosphere inside the stadium  

Speaking to reporters post-match, Olayinka said: "The team fought, we fought from beginning to the end, and I think we deserve the win. I am happy to score this goal and everyone is very excited.

"It was an incredible atmosphere because this was my first game here on the pitch and I saw the fans come to support, it was a really amazing atmosphere."

Explaining his decision to join APOEL FC, Olayinka revealed that  he knew about the club’s reputation. 

"I've known APOEL for a long time because I follow the Champions League. I played in Northern Cyprus but I do watch a lot of football and I know about APOEL so it's a good opportunity for me to come here."

Predominantly deployed on the left wing, Olayinka is a versatile attacker capable of operating as a centre-forward, right winger or second striker when required.

When asked whether he prefers playing as a left winger or a striker, he responded: "For me it doesn't matter. I just want to play in attack and then do my job.": 

Concluding his remarks, Olayinka credited the team's strong mentality for the victory, adding that everyone understands the target, the goal and what must be achieved.
